Solution for v^2-24v+16=0 equation:


Simplifying
v2 + -24v + 16 = 0

Reorder the terms:
16 + -24v + v2 = 0

Solving
16 + -24v + v2 = 0

Solving for variable 'v'.

Begin completing the square.

Move the constant term to the right:

Add '-16' to each side of the equation.
16 + -24v + -16 + v2 = 0 + -16

Reorder the terms:
16 + -16 + -24v + v2 = 0 + -16

Combine like terms: 16 + -16 = 0
0 + -24v + v2 = 0 + -16
-24v + v2 = 0 + -16

Combine like terms: 0 + -16 = -16
-24v + v2 = -16

The v term is -24v.  Take half its coefficient (-12).
Square it (144) and add it to both sides.

Add '144' to each side of the equation.
-24v + 144 + v2 = -16 + 144

Reorder the terms:
144 + -24v + v2 = -16 + 144

Combine like terms: -16 + 144 = 128
144 + -24v + v2 = 128

Factor a perfect square on the left side:
(v + -12)(v + -12) = 128

Calculate the square root of the right side: 11.313708499

Break this problem into two subproblems by setting 
(v + -12) equal to 11.313708499 and -11.313708499.

Subproblem 1

v + -12 = 11.313708499 Simplifying v + -12 = 11.313708499 Reorder the terms: -12 + v = 11.313708499 Solving -12 + v = 11.313708499 Solving for variable 'v'. Move all terms containing v to the left, all other terms to the right. Add '12' to each side of the equation. -12 + 12 + v = 11.313708499 + 12 Combine like terms: -12 + 12 = 0 0 + v = 11.313708499 + 12 v = 11.313708499 + 12 Combine like terms: 11.313708499 + 12 = 23.313708499 v = 23.313708499 Simplifying v = 23.313708499

Subproblem 2

v + -12 = -11.313708499 Simplifying v + -12 = -11.313708499 Reorder the terms: -12 + v = -11.313708499 Solving -12 + v = -11.313708499 Solving for variable 'v'. Move all terms containing v to the left, all other terms to the right. Add '12' to each side of the equation. -12 + 12 + v = -11.313708499 + 12 Combine like terms: -12 + 12 = 0 0 + v = -11.313708499 + 12 v = -11.313708499 + 12 Combine like terms: -11.313708499 + 12 = 0.686291501 v = 0.686291501 Simplifying v = 0.686291501

Solution

The solution to the problem is based on the solutions from the subproblems. v = {23.313708499, 0.686291501}
